Daniel Blinkhorn

Residence: Coogee, Sydney, Australia

daniel is a composer and digital media artist who was born in the Blue Mountains, just west of Sydney. He has studied composition as well as music education at a number of universities including the University of New England, University of Griffith, University of Wollongong and the Australian Institute of Music and has a BMus (Hons), MMus and a MA(R)…

daniel’s works have been performed at numerous international events including: ICMC, ACMC, FEMF, Diffusion 2006, Biennale Music en Scene (GRAME), Unruly Music: Peck School of the Arts, BEAF, International Symposium of the World Forum for Acoustic Ecology, Empirical Soundings, InsideOut and Full Sail, with his works for video exhibited at Festival Internacional de Vídeo y Artes Digitales, Spain, Cologne OFF II, Cologne, PI5 Video Festival — National Museum Szczecin/ Poland, 2nd Digital Art Festival, Rosario/Argentina, 8th CHROMA, Festival de Arte Audiovisual, Mexico, Victory Media Arts, Dallas and the IPFF…

In 2006 daniel was awarded 2nd prize in the Diffusion 2006 International Competition for Electroacoustic Music Composition (RTÉ Lyric FM/ Centre for Computational Musicology and Computer Music, Ireland)
He was an artist in residence at the Atlantic Centre for the Arts, Florida, two of his work’s were preselected at the 33e Concours Internationaux de Musique et d’Art Sonore Electroacoustiques de Bourge, residence category,
one of his works was selected as part of the Australian National Selection for representation at the ISCM (World Music Days, 2007) and he was awarded an honourable mention for the originality of the score in the XXV Concorso Internazionale di Composizione Originale per Banda, Italia…

As well as lecturing and composing daniel is currently completing a Doctorate at the University of Wollongong and a Graduate Diploma in Education at the University of New England…
